Architecture of Observation Towers

It seems to be human nature to enjoy a view, getting the higher ground and taking in our surroundings has become a significant aspect of architecture across the world. Observation towers which allow visitors to climb and observe their surroundings, provide a chance to take in the beauty of the land while at the same time adding something unique and impressive to the landscape.

Suspension

The suspension system is an integral part of a car that helps to keep the tires in contact with the road for stability and traction. It also helps to smooth the ride and handle rough roads by keeping the driver under control and reducing the possibility of rollovers.

In a truck accident the suspension of a vehicle could be damaged due to the impact of the crash. This could result in damage to the brakes, steering and tires, which could impact the way the vehicle handles.

You should check your car immediately if it's leaky of fluid, has damaged or worn suspension components, or if you notice a bumpy or uneven ride. These problems are caused by a number of causes, including rust, corrosion and welding flaws.

You must also ensure that the tires are properly inflated, which will help to prevent issues with the suspension system. Inflated tires that are too high or not properly tires can cause your vehicle's front to shake and feel unstable.

A car may feel as if it is under an earthquake when it comes across the top of a big bump. This could be due to damaged or worn suspension components which allow the vehicle to move excessively.

This can lead to a loss of control of the vehicle and even an accident. The driver could be able to feel a pull on one side or the other , if the tires aren't able to absorb small bumps and potholes.

Suspension damage can cause a driver lose control while turning, which can pose an immediate danger for both the driver and passengers. This could lead to a collision that could cause serious injuries.

If a vehicle is involved in a truck accident, it is important to have it checked by a trained repair technician. They are trained to detect damage and fix the suspension after an accident. They can refer to the frame specifications of the vehicle or other measurements to determine if the vehicle's suspension is damaged. They can also utilize a tram gauge to measure the suspension's deformation.

Tires

Tires are an integral part of every vehicle. They give traction, lower the consumption of fuel, and enhance the handling of a vehicle. If tires are not maintained properly or are defective, they can cause serious accidents.

Defective tires are usually a result of manufacturing errors or design flaws, which could cause safety issues. These flaws can be found in new tires or worsen over time and cause drivers to lose control of their vehicles.

The National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A), has created an online database that lists tires that are susceptible to recalls. It also provides information about violations of federal motor vehicle safety standards. These tire recalls notify consumers via mail and provide alternatives for replacing or repairing the defective item.

Truck tires are under the most stress on the road, especially when they're running on roads that are cracked or have potholes. These conditions could cause tires to explode or tear.
